VPN连接后断网问题深度解析与解决方案
在当今远程办公和跨地域访问日益普遍的背景下,虚拟私人网络(VPN)已成为许多企业和个人用户保障网络安全与隐私的重要工具,不少用户在成功连接到VPN后,却遭遇了“连上即断网”的问题——即设备虽然显示已连接至VPN服务器,但无法访问互联网或局域网资源,这不仅影响工作效率,还可能引发对网络配置或VPN服务稳定性的质疑,作为网络工程师,我将从原理、常见原因到实际解决步骤,为你系统性地剖析这一问题。
我们需要理解VPN的基本工作原理,当客户端连接到VPN时,它会建立一条加密隧道,所有流量都会通过该隧道转发至远程服务器,这意味着,本地默认路由会被覆盖,所有出站流量不再走本机ISP线路,而是经由VPN服务商的出口IP发出,如果配置不当或服务器端异常,就会导致流量中断。
常见的断网原因包括:
-
路由冲突:某些情况下,本地路由器或防火墙规则未正确处理VPN路由表,导致流量被错误丢弃,Windows系统的“始终使用此连接的默认网关”选项若开启,可能使所有流量都通过VPN出口,而若该出口不可达,则出现断网。
-
DNS污染或解析失败:部分免费或非正规VPN服务未提供可靠DNS解析,或未启用Split Tunneling(分流模式),导致域名无法解析,即使物理连接正常也表现为“断网”。
-
MTU不匹配:由于封装协议(如PPTP、OpenVPN、WireGuard)增加头部开销,若本地MTU设置过大,会导致数据包分片失败,进而丢包甚至连接中断。
-
防火墙/杀毒软件拦截:企业级防火墙或安全软件可能误判VPN流量为恶意行为,主动阻断相关端口(如UDP 1194用于OpenVPN)。
-
ISP限速或封禁:部分运营商对特定端口或协议进行QoS限制,尤其在使用公共Wi-Fi或移动热点时更明显。
解决思路如下:
- 第一步:检查是否真的“断网”,可尝试ping一个公网IP(如8.8.8.8)而非域名,判断是否为DNS问题。
- 第二步:关闭“使用默认网关”选项(Windows下:右键VPN属性 → IPv4 → “使用默认网关”取消勾选)。
- 第三步:手动配置DNS服务器(推荐使用Google DNS 8.8.8.8 或 Cloudflare 1.1.1.1)。
- 第四步:调整MTU值(建议设置为1400或1300),避免因分片失败造成丢包。
- 第五步:临时禁用防火墙或杀毒软件测试是否为误拦截。
- 第六步:更换不同协议(如从PPTP切换至OpenVPN UDP)或选择更稳定的VPN服务商。
若上述方法无效,建议抓包分析(使用Wireshark)查看是否有TCP重传、ICMP超时等现象,进一步定位问题根源,联系VPN提供商获取技术支持也是高效手段。
VPN连上即断网并非罕见故障,而是多因素交织的结果,掌握基础网络知识并具备排查逻辑,是每位IT从业者必备技能,希望本文能助你快速恢复网络通畅,提升远程协作效率。




